| psychotherapy |
Body-Oriented Psychotherapy seeks to enhance the psychotherapeutic process by incorporating a range of massage, bodywork and movement techniques. Acknowledging the mind/body link, practitioners may use light touch, softer deep-tissue manipulation, breathing techniques, movement, exercise or body-awareness techniques to help address emotional issues.

| psychotherapy |
involves regular sessions with a psychotherapist trained to connect with people in emotional need and to help them grow, learn, and heal. Many things may lead you to psychotherapy including feelings of sorrow or unhappiness, stress or sleeplessness, or a conviction that it's time to make changes in your life and you're not sure where to begin.
